Thailand has been known to spearhead the fight to legalise marijuana and as of now, medical marijuana is legal in the country with research labs as well as farms being opened to facilitate the whole thing. Thailand has taken the next step in embracing the benefits of the plant as a new cannabis cafe is now open in Bangkok.

The 420 Cannabis Bar in Bangkok is able to serve CBD infused tea and snacks thanks to the new ruling that now allows weed to be used for commercial purposes by licensed entities. The cafe opened its doors on February 11, and customers can now chill while sipping on drinks with cannabidiol, or CBD, the cannabis plant extract believed to offer therapeutic effects without the high. As shared by the cafe on its page, the cafe is…

“…the country’s first to offer a range of drinks, bakery, wine, beer and fruit juices that contain cannabidiol, or CBD, a substance from the cannabis plant that is said to offer therapeutic effects without getting users intoxicated. Cannabis’s tetrahydrocannabinol compound — commonly known as THC — is the psychoactive ingredient that gives users a high. But unlike THC, CBD is typically used to help reduce stress without the high.”
Apart from the delicious drinks, as reported by Coconuts, the cafe also offers CBD infused snacks such as baked pot leaf and spinach with cheese, CBD chocolate chip cookies and CBD brownies.
